Output 9633e495ebce8700561f294162376ba68d84e9e8aceef0c940b619dbb5073282:1

value
17015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c58fd6f569e08a5592e198fb9e1a9bfbaad2f8 OP_EQUAL
address
3Dyd966XYgbMT8EgvZnyrDYFiorPUEaGvU
transaction
9633e495ebce8700561f294162376ba68d84e9e8aceef0c940b619dbb5073282
spent
true